‘Two and a Half Men’ Season 11: Amber Tamblyn is Charlie’s Lost Lesbian Daughter
‘Two and a Half Men’ Season 11: Amber Tamblyn is Charlie’s Lost Lesbian Daughter
‘Two and a Half Men’ Season 11: Amber Tamblyn is Charlie’s Lost Lesbian Daughter
Long in the tooth though it might be, CBS powerhouse 'Two and a Half Men' has just found its next (more chromosomally literal) half-man. After an extensive search for an actress to portray Charlie Harper (Sheen)'s long-lost lesbian daughter, former 'Joan of Arcadia' and 'House' star Amber Tamblyn has been selected to fill the recurring role when 'Two and a Half Men' season 11 picks up this fall. Chuck Lorre’s ‘Mom’ Adds Justin Long and Octavia Spencer
Chuck Lorre’s ‘Mom’ Adds Justin Long and Octavia Spencer
Chuck Lorre’s ‘Mom’ Adds Justin Long and Octavia Spencer
CBS sitcom magnate Chuck Lorre may be on his fourth airing show for the network with the debut of upcoming Anna Faris sitcom 'Mom,' but that hasn't stopped the freshman comedy from flexing its muscles with casting just yet. Erstwhile 'New Girl' guest and rom-com staple Justin Long has joined the cast, along with 'The Help' Oscar-winner Octavia Spencer, but who might the duo portray?
